See how happy . . . and cozy warm she looks!  Her sweater coat and cap set is knit with merino wool/angora yarn.  It is slightly fuzzy with a halo and is quite soft.  The sweater coat is knit with my pattern.  I shortened it by one buttonhole’s length and omitted the pockets.  The hand embroidery on this sweater coat and cap is pretty and feminine and coordinates with the dress print.

The cotton print I selected for the dress is a calico from a “Little House on the Prairie” collection.  The Cluny laces in this ensemble are from England.  The scalloped lace is cotton and the sturdier lace used for the sash is nylon, both are off white in color.

The capelet was made from my “Eyelet Capelet” pattern, but I used two-strands of lace weight yarn held together instead of one-strand of fingering weight yarn for a marled effect.  One thing to remember about holding two-strands together is that the colors will mix, so in this case the natural color mixes with the pink to lighten it.
